Read moreThe Lady Bulldog basketball team fell Jan. 3 to the tenth-ranked Navarro Lady Panthers, who led throughout the game and relied on their superior free throw shooting and layups to win the game Senior Summer Haby put the game’s first points on the board with a soft two on a breakaway. The Lady Bulldogs’ shooting was off; after Haby’s initial goal, the team was not able to put it in the hoop. Brooklyn Grabs got in a good block against Navarro but fouled in the process, allowing the Panthers to go to the free throw line for two more points. The first quarter ended with the Bulldogs at two points while the Panthers had 16.

Read moreThe Lady Bulldogs led the game through 3 quarters to win over the Poteet Lady Aggies 36 to 29. Although the Aggies are listed as 3A, they gave the Bulldogs a good fight two days after Christmas in the Competition Gym. The Bulldogs were down by 2 going into the 2nd quarter but led the rest of the game against Poteet.
